  • Patent number: 8418172
    Abstract: Flexible systems and methods are disclosed that may be used for provisioning, configuring, and controlling a host embodied in a cable set top box or other digital device attached to a digital communication network, such as cable distribution network. An enhanced services system maintains various host files for various types of hosts that a cable subscriber may purchase and connect to the cable network. The Enhanced Services Server interacts with the host using the host files. The host files may be downloaded from the host manufacturer into a database that distributes the modules as required to the various enhanced services systems. The host may be purchased by the cable subscriber and provisioning may be initiated by the retailer at the time of purchase using a provisioning network interacting with the appropriate cable system serving the subscriber.   • Patent number: 8056106
    Abstract: The present invention provides a method for an interactive media services system to provide media to a user through an interactive media services client device. The client device is coupled to a programmable media services server device. The method includes the step of implementing an interactive media guide. Additionally, the client device is implemented to present the interactive media guide to the user. A system operator is provided an interface to the programmable media services server. Control options are provided within the interface to allow the system operator to configure a plurality of rental options available to the user. Finally the interactive media service system is implemented such that the plurality of rental options can be executed by the user in a requested active media session.

  • Publication number: 20080046524
    Abstract: The present invention comprises customizable, multimedia messaging over a subscriber television system, such as a cable or satellite system, utilizing a service independent framework. The present invention comprises a multimedia messaging (MMM) server generally located at a headend of a cable or satellite system, and an MMM client at a communications terminal located remotely with respect to the MMM server. A service provider or operator defines a message configuration that is utilized to present the message content to one or more subscribers. The message configuration includes parameters that control the presentation of the message content. The MMM server receives an MMM request from a service application, and in response thereto, generates an MMM request which is sent to the communications terminal, and more particularly, to the MMM client. The MMM client processes the MMM request, including the retrieval of any message content or the message configuration.

  • Publication number: 20070116048
    Abstract: An intelligent multiplexer is disclosed for multiplexing various types of traffic on a cable network. The multiplexer receives information regarding the traffic currently provided, or anticipated to be provided, including the associated bandwidth and dynamically allocates bandwidth for the various traffics types as required. A rules database may be consulted to determine how the re-allocation of traffic data is to occur. In this manner, flexibility is provided for accommodate various service demands and more efficiently using network resources.

  • Publication number: 20050177616
    Abstract: In a system for managing and selecting a service to fulfill a request, a client application can issue a message to execute a function. A service proxy can receive the message from the client application and identify one of a plurality of services to execute the function in accordance with one or more rules. Upon identifying the service to execute the function in accordance with the rules, the service proxy can send a message to the identified service to execute the function. Alternatively, the service proxy can send the identity of the identified service to the client application. The client application can then send the message to execute the function to the identified service upon receiving the identity of the identified service from the service proxy.
